Output 65c0bcd0e02746a523ad0d3224698e302caa695aa706563c51622de73df180b3:172

value
490920
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a250bb937b710fee4e653dbc315419658e3ca2a OP_EQUAL
address
3HCfB9BYkNdWeuWLm5JH67wufLoZ7xgAXX
transaction
65c0bcd0e02746a523ad0d3224698e302caa695aa706563c51622de73df180b3
confirmations
231615
spent
true